HUB hero image

How to Travel from

Banja Luka to Heidelberg

by Rideshare, Route or Car

Banja Luka
+0
Heidelberg
Transport search to Heidelberg
Banja Luka
+0
Heidelberg
Building a composite car route
Cheapest
Best Offer!
Car
9 h 46 min
1069 km.
from $58
Composite Route Car Only

Ten ways to Travel from Banja Luka to Heidelberg

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Airlines

Ryanair

Website:
ryanair.com/
Plane from Banja Luka International Airport to Karlsruhe/Baden-Baden
Ave. Duration:
1h 40m
Frequency:
Monday, Thursday, and Saturday
Estimated price:
$37.89–$239.99
Plane from Banja Luka International Airport to Memmingen
Ave. Duration:
1h 20m
Frequency:
Monday, Tuesday, Wednesday, Friday, and Sunday
Estimated price:
$22.74–$252.62
Plane from Zagreb Airport to Karlsruhe/Baden-Baden
Ave. Duration:
1h 35m
Frequency:
Monday, Friday, Saturday, and Sunday
Estimated price:
$59.37–$1,768.34

Lufthansa

Website:
lufthansa.com/
Plane from Split Airport to Frankfurt
Ave. Duration:
1h 52m
Frequency:
Every day
Estimated price:
$164.20–$1,010.48
Plane from Zagreb Airport to Frankfurt
Ave. Duration:
1h 41m
Frequency:
Every day
Estimated price:
$176.83–$517.87
Plane from Sarajevo to Frankfurt
Ave. Duration:
2h 5m
Frequency:
Every day
Estimated price:
$214.73–$694.70

Austrian Airlines

Website:
austrian.com/?sc_lang=en&cc=ZZ
Plane from Split Airport to Frankfurt
Ave. Duration:
4h 10m
Frequency:
Monday, Wednesday, and Friday
Estimated price:
$214.73–$821.01
Plane from Zagreb Airport to Frankfurt
Ave. Duration:
3h 50m
Frequency:
Every day
Estimated price:
$252.62–$593.66
Plane from Sarajevo to Frankfurt
Ave. Duration:
3h 57m
Frequency:
Every day
Estimated price:
$227.36–$568.39

Croatia Airlines

Website:
croatiaairlines.com/
Plane from Split Airport to Frankfurt
Ave. Duration:
1h 52m
Frequency:
Every day
Estimated price:
$164.20–$1,010.48
Plane from Zagreb Airport to Frankfurt
Ave. Duration:
1h 41m
Frequency:
Every day
Estimated price:
$176.83–$517.87
Plane from Sarajevo to Frankfurt
Ave. Duration:
4h 10m
Frequency:
Every day
Estimated price:
$353.67–$606.29

Air Serbia

Website:
airserbia.com/en/welcome
Plane from Sarajevo to Frankfurt
Ave. Duration:
4h 25m
Frequency:
Monday, Wednesday, Friday, and Sunday
Estimated price:
$119.99–$884.17

Condor Flugdienst

Website:
condor.com
Plane from Split Airport to Frankfurt
Ave. Duration:
1h 50m
Frequency:
Friday
Estimated price:
$60.63–$252.62

Airbus France

Website:
airbus.com/
Plane from Split Airport to Frankfurt
Ave. Duration:
1h 55m
Frequency:
Friday
Estimated price:
$265.25–$1,010.48

Train operators

TGV inOui

Phone:
+33 1 84 94 36 35
Website:
sncf-connect.com/en-en
Train from Baden-Baden to Karlsruhe
Ave. Duration:
22 min
Frequency:
Once daily
Estimated price:
$16.42–$45.47

NS

Phone:
+31 30 751 5155
Website:
ns.nl/
Train from Frankfurt to Mannheim,
Ave. Duration:
31 min
Frequency:
Twice daily
Estimated price:
$13.89–$34.10

Deutsche Bahn Intercity-Express

Phone:
+49 30 311-682904
Website:
bahn.de/
Train from Baden-Baden to Karlsruhe
Ave. Duration:
17 min
Frequency:
3 times a day
Estimated price:
$25.26–$29.05
Train from Karlsruhe Hauptbahnhof to Heidelberg,
Ave. Duration:
44 min
Frequency:
4 times a day
Estimated price:
$29.05–$34.10
Train from Rosenheim to Heidelberg,
Ave. Duration:
3h 42m
Frequency:
3 times a day
Estimated price:
$75.79–$88.42
Train from Hauptbahnhof to Heidelberg,
Ave. Duration:
1h 7m
Frequency:
Every 4 hours
Estimated price:
$35.37–$40.42
Train from Frankfurt to Mannheim,
Ave. Duration:
32 min
Frequency:
Hourly
Estimated price:
$32.84–$36.63
Train from Memmingen to Ulm
Ave. Duration:
32 min
Frequency:
Twice daily
Estimated price:
$29.05–$34.10
Train from Ulm Hauptbahnhof to Heidelberg,
Ave. Duration:
1h 41m
Frequency:
4 times a day
Estimated price:
$49.26–$54.31

Railjet

Phone:
+43 51717
Website:
o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/railjet
Train from Hauptbahnhof to Heidelberg,
Ave. Duration:
41 min
Frequency:
Once daily
Estimated price:
$21.47–$32.84
Train from Ulm Hauptbahnhof to Heidelberg,
Ave. Duration:
1h 43m
Frequency:
Once daily
Estimated price:
$35.37–$53.05

ÖBB EuroCity

Phone:
+43 5 1717
Website:
oebb.at/en/reiseplanung-services/im-zug/unsere-zuege/eurocity-intercity
Train from Rosenheim to Heidelberg,
Ave. Duration:
3h 42m
Frequency:
Twice daily
Estimated price:
$63.15–$94.73
Train from Hauptbahnhof to Heidelberg,
Ave. Duration:
39 min
Frequency:
Twice daily
Estimated price:
$30.31–$42.95
Train from Ulm Hauptbahnhof to Heidelberg,
Ave. Duration:
1h 42m
Frequency:
Twice daily
Estimated price:
$41.68–$58.10
Train from Villach Hbf to Heidelberg
Ave. Duration:
7h 28m
Frequency:
Once daily
Estimated price:
$101.05–$151.57

Deutsche Bahn Regional

Phone:
+49 30 2970
Website:
bahn.de/
Train from Baden-Baden to Karlsruhe
Ave. Duration:
20 min
Frequency:
Hourly
Estimated price:
$10.74–$15.16
Train from Karlsruhe Hauptbahnhof to Heidelberg,
Ave. Duration:
45 min
Frequency:
Every 30 minutes
Estimated price:
$13.89–$20.21
Train from Memmingen to Ulm
Ave. Duration:
34 min
Frequency:
Hourly
Estimated price:
$13.89–$20.21

Croatian Railways (HŽPP)

Phone:
060 333 444
Website:
hzpp.hr/en
Train from Zagreb Glavni Kol. to Stuttgart
Ave. Duration:
13h
Frequency:
Twice daily
Estimated price:
$54.31–$75.79
Train from Nova Gradiska to Villach
Ave. Duration:
7h 21m
Frequency:
Once daily
Estimated price:
$25.26–$35.37

Flixtrain

Phone:
+49 30 300 137 100
Website:
flixtrain.de/
Train from Baden-Baden to Karlsruhe
Ave. Duration:
31 min
Frequency:
Once daily
Estimated price:
$2.65–$3.79
Train from Karlsruhe Hauptbahnhof to Heidelberg,
Ave. Duration:
39 min
Frequency:
4 times a week
Estimated price:
$4.93–$7.58
Train from Hauptbahnhof to Heidelberg,
Ave. Duration:
46 min
Frequency:
Twice daily
Estimated price:
$8.21–$12.00

Urlaubs-Express

Phone:
+49 (0) 221 800 20 820
Website:
urlaubs-express.de/
Train from Villach Hbf ARZ to Würzburg
Ave. Duration:
7h 40m
Frequency:
Once a week
Estimated price:
$119.99–$151.57

Railways of Bosnia and Herzegovina (ŽFBH)

Phone:
+387 33 655-330
Website:
zfbh.ba/
Train from Kakanj to Alipasin
Ave. Duration:
58 min
Frequency:
Twice daily
Estimated price:
$2.53–$3.41

Stadtwerke Augsburg

Phone:
0821 6500-6500
Website:
sw-augsburg.de/privatkunden/mobilitaet/
Train from Baden-Baden to Karlsruhe
Ave. Duration:
36 min
Frequency:
3 times a day

Bus operators

Croatia Bus

Phone:
+385 (0) 91 6113 073
Website:
croatiabus.hr/en/
Bus from Banja Luka, Autobuska Stanica to Zagreb,
Ave. Duration:
3h 25m
Frequency:
Once daily

Pepeks Zagreb

Phone:
+385 (0)98 39 89 59
Website:
pepeks.hr/home/
Bus from Banja Luka, Autobuska Stanica to Zagreb,
Ave. Duration:
2h 50m
Frequency:
5 times a day
Estimated price:
$28.34

Biss-Tours

Phone:
+387 32 246 306
Website:
biss-tours.ba/
Bus from Banja Luka, Autobuska Stanica to Prijedor
Ave. Duration:
1h
Frequency:
Twice daily
Estimated price:
$10.74–$13.89

Bocac Tours

Phone:
051/215-725
Website:
bocactours.com
Bus from Banja Luka, Autobuska Stanica to Prijedor
Ave. Duration:
1h 14m
Frequency:
3 times a day
Estimated price:
$5.18–$8.21
Bus from Banja Luka, Autobuska Stanica to Split
Ave. Duration:
2h 2m
Frequency:
Once daily
Estimated price:
$24.00–$36.63

ZAM Tours

Phone:
+387 65 803 830
Website:
zamtours.net/
Bus from Banja Luka, Autobuska Stanica to Prijedor
Ave. Duration:
55 min
Frequency:
Once daily
Bus from Banja Luka, Autobuska Stanica to Doboj
Ave. Duration:
2h 30m
Frequency:
Once daily
Estimated price:
$36.97

Centrotrans Eurolines

Phone:
+387 33 770 889
Website:
centrotrans.com/
Bus from Banja Luka, Autobuska Stanica to Zagreb,
Ave. Duration:
2h 45m
Frequency:
Once daily
Estimated price:
$18.95–$27.79

Globtour

Phone:
+387 36 651-393
Website:
globtour.com/
Bus from Banja Luka, Autobuska Stanica to Zagreb,
Ave. Duration:
3h 20m
Frequency:
Once daily
Estimated price:
$13.89–$17.68

Toping Trade

Phone:
+387/(0)52-751-339
Website:
topingtrade.com/
Bus from Banja Luka, Autobuska Stanica to Zagreb,
Ave. Duration:
3h 25m
Frequency:
Twice daily
Estimated price:
$37.35

Autoprevoz Banja Luka

Phone:
+387 51 214 994
Website:
autoprevoz-gs.com/
Bus from Banja Luka, Autobuska Stanica to Prijedor
Ave. Duration:
1h
Frequency:
Once daily

Cicko Commerce

Phone:
+387 63 330 312
Website:
cicko-tg.com/index.html
Bus from Banja Luka, Autobuska Stanica to Mannheim,
Ave. Duration:
16h 15m
Frequency:
Once daily

Evropa Tours

Phone:
+387 61 197 121
Website:
evropatours.com/
Bus from Prijedor to Rosenheim
Ave. Duration:
5h 12m
Frequency:
Once daily

Zak Tours

Phone:
+387 51 211-850
Website:
facebook.com/p/%C5%BDak-Tours-Banja-Luka-100090491266105/?locale=be_BY
Bus from Banja Luka, Autobuska Stanica to Split
Ave. Duration:
5h 10m
Frequency:
Once daily

Bakic Reisen

Phone:
+49 7476 9476939
Website:
bakic-reisen.com/
Bus from Banja Luka, Autobuska Stanica to Mannheim,
Ave. Duration:
19h 48m
Frequency:
Twice a week

Livno Bus

Phone:
+387 34 206 501
Website:
livnobus.com/hr
Bus from Banja Luka, Autobuska Stanica to Mannheim,
Ave. Duration:
17h 10m
Frequency:
Once daily
Estimated price:
$123.24

Questions and Answers

What is the cheapest way to get from Banja Luka to Heidelberg?

The cheapest way to get from Banja Luka to Heidelberg is to bus and night train and train which costs $65.22 - $119.57 and takes 19h.

What is the fastest way to get from Banja Luka to Heidelberg?

The fastest way to get from Banja Luka to Heidelberg is to fly and train which takes 6h 41m and costs $43.48 - $282.61 .

Is there a direct bus between Banja Luka and Heidelberg?

No, there is no direct bus from Banja Luka to Heidelberg. However, there are services departing from Banja Luka, Autobuska Stanica and arriving at Heidelberg Pre Waypoint via Mannheim central bus station. The journey, including transfers, takes approximately 17h 22m.

How far is it from Banja Luka to Heidelberg?

The distance between Banja Luka and Heidelberg is 940 km. The road distance is 1070.5 km.

How do I travel from Banja Luka to Heidelberg without a car?

The best way to get from Banja Luka to Heidelberg without a car is to bus and train which takes 12h 8m and costs .

How long does it take to get from Banja Luka to Heidelberg?

It takes approximately 6h 41m to get from Banja Luka to Heidelberg, including transfers.

Where do I catch the Banja Luka to Heidelberg bus from?

Banja Luka to Heidelberg bus services, operated by Cicko Commerce, depart from Banja Luka, Autobuska Stanica station.

Where does the Banja Luka to Heidelberg bus arrive?

Banja Luka to Heidelberg bus services, operated by Cicko Commerce, arrive at Mannheim, Hauptbahnhof station.

Can I drive from Banja Luka to Heidelberg?

Yes, the driving distance between Banja Luka to Heidelberg is 1071 km. It takes approximately 9h 50m to drive from Banja Luka to Heidelberg.

Where can I stay near Heidelberg?

There are 1083+ hotels available in Heidelberg. Prices start at $56.30 per night.
+0